at a sudden point images where not shown any more.
investigating all the filenames i niticed one file with a é in the filename.
renaming the file solved the problem.
strange thing was that in the ftp filemanager it was not visible but on the files on my local hard drive it was.

I renamed image/cache/data/ folder and refreshed
I look into my host log and see this error :
So I look further on files that look missing. With firebug, I saw that the file admin/view/javascript/jquery/jstree/jquery.tree.min.js was missing[Mon Oct 01 15:24:00 2012] [error] [client 72.11.160.210] File does not exist: /home/dfripeco/public_html/admin/view/javascript/jquery/jstree, referer: http://www.dfripe.com/admin/index.php?r ... field=imag
I really don't why the file was missing? Does it disappear? Is it a host problem? Anyway, I just downloaded the file and upload it to OpenCart, that fix the problem, now image are showing correctly.
OpenCart version : 1.5.3.1

Initially, I moved all of my images to images/data and thn tried to select them using the image manager. The IM only showed me the "no image" thumbnails along with the names of my images.
So then I moved my images out of images/data and tried to add them all in using the IM. Same thing. Only the "no_image.jpg". Also it started freezing and giving blank pages.
I had some images in the IM that had been previously uploaded, the cart image and all the imags from the demo store, so I tried adding them to my products. It added them, but then when I tried to save the product opencart froze and gave me blank pages.
The log file in cart/admin told me nothing, so I checked the apache log, and found this error:
[Fri Apr 05 16:03:05 2013] [error] [client 127.0.0.1] PHP Fatal error: Call to undefined function imagecreatefrompng() in /var/www/webapp/cart/system/library/image.php on line 32, referer: http://localhost/cart/admin/index.php?r ... oduct_id=1
I researched and learned that that error is from the "GD" php module (image processing) not being installed. So I checked phpinfo() and sure enough, GD did not seem to be there.
I use ubuntu, so I ran sudo apt-get install php5-gd
to get the "GD" module. (This is something that your hosting service would have to do in you aren't running opencart locally).
Now I can do anything with images. They upload and display without problems. I haven't testing just moving them all into image/data but I'm sure that will work fine to.
So check phpinfo on your hosting service and make sure GD is supported. It should output something like:
gd
GD Support enabled
GD Version 2.0
FreeType Support enabled
FreeType Linkage with freetype
FreeType Version 2.4.8
T1Lib Support enabled
GIF Read Support enabled
GIF Create Support enabled
JPEG Support enabled
libJPEG Version unknown
PNG Support enabled
libPNG Version 1.2.46
WBMP Support enabled
